All the instructions I have seen for making preserved lemons say to cut them in quarters without going all the way through. But when I use them, I always have to spend time mincing them to my desired consistency. This time I got smart and used the shredding blade on the Cuisinart. Now all I have to do is dip in my spoon.

Blend salt lemon with Greek yogurt, shallot infused olive oil, and champagne vinegar, and honey, you've created a fantastic salad dressing! #cooking #lactofermentation

I haven't worked with llama fiber, but I have worked with alpaca, and found it so incredibly dusty that no amount of washing was enough. Even after multiple, intensive sprayings with the kitchen sprayer at full blast in a colander, there was still fine dust on my fingers and in my lungs when I tried to spin it. My tubes are pretty sensitive, so I had to give the fiber to someone else.
